Aussehen

The Evans' Deer Moss is a grayish-green, shrubby lichen that forms dense, intricately branched clumps, resembling miniature coral or tiny deer antlers. Unlike true mosses, it has a rigid, dry texture and often appears bleached white at its tips. It lacks leaves and roots, distinguishing it from most plants.

Besondere Fähigkeiten

Fähigkeit

Air Eater

Evans' Deer Moss can absorb all its water and nutrients directly from the air and rain, helping it survive in harsh, nutrient-poor soils.

Fähigkeit

Symbiotic Power

Evans' Deer Moss has a fungus and an alga living as one, the alga makes food and the fungus provides shelter and absorbs minerals.

Fähigkeit

Pioneer Pathfinder

Evans' Deer Moss can grow on bare ground where other plants struggle, helping to stabilize sandy soil and begin new ecosystems.

Ökologische Zusammenhänge

eaten by

White-tailed Deer

Odocoileus virginianus

Provides a food source for deer during lean times.

depends on

Longleaf Pine

Pinus palustris

Thrives in the acidic, sandy conditions created by longleaf pine forests.

shelters

Common Mound Ant

Formica subsericea

Small insects and ants often find shelter within its dense, branching mats.
